CHARLESTON, SC – Thursday, April 19, 2018 – Coastal Community Foundation (CCF), a grantmaking foundation dedicated to serving coastal South Carolina, invites nonprofit organizations to apply for grants through its current funding cycle. The Foundation is accepting applications now for its Northern Lowcountry Regional Grants Program, the Cooper River Bridge Run Fund, and the Realtors Housing Opportunities Fund (RHOF).
Find more info about eligibility for each of these grant programs below.
Northern Lowcountry Regional Grant
Grants are available annually to non-profit organizations serving all program areas throughout the following Counties: Berkeley, Charleston, and Dorchester, as well as organizations focused on the Arts in Georgetown County. Cooper River Bridge Run Grant
Grants are available annually to programs in Berkeley, Charleston and Dorchester Counties that promote regular physical activity that will encourage continuous participation in the Cooper River Bridge Run and related activities such as the Bridge Run Kid’s Run. Realtors Housing Opportunity Fund (RHOF)
Grants from RHOF are available to nonprofit organizations focused on the repair or rehabilitation of low-to-moderate income housing, creation of new affordable housing, and education to encourage responsible homeownership in Berkeley, Charleston and Dorchester Counties. The deadline for submissions is Friday, June 1, 2018. To apply, nonprofits must create a login to Coastal Community Foundation’s grant application portal. It may take up to 48 hours for login requests to be approved. Please direct questions about programs to the contacts assigned above. About Coastal Community Foundation
Coastal Community Foundation empowers individuals, families and organizations to make a lasting impact through permanent, endowed funds for charitable giving. The Foundation serves Beaufort, Berkeley, Charleston, Colleton, Dorchester, Georgetown, Hampton, Horry and Jasper counties.
